Russian Hackers Steal 1.2 Billion Usernames And Passwords
"As long as your data is somewhere on the World Wide Web, you may be affected by this breach," Hold said in a statement on its website.
"As long as your data is somewhere on the World Wide Web, you may be affected by this breach," Hold said in a statement on its website.